Who is Assane Diao Diaoune of Real Betis?

Assane Diao Diaoune, born on 7th September 2005, has quickly made a name for himself in the world of football as a dynamic winger playing for Real Betis.

With roots in Senegal and raised in Spain from a young age, Diao represents the latter in international youth competitions.

Emerging from the academies of CD Badajoz, CP Flecha Negra, and Balón de Cádiz CF, his career took a significant turn in 2021 when he joined Real Betis' youth setup on a contract that extends until 2024.

Initially starting his career in midfield, Diao's attacking flair soon saw him being repositioned as a left winger, a role in which he has flourished, particularly with the reserves in the Segunda Federación starting in 2022.

What Makes Diao Stand Out at Real Betis?

Diao extended his contract with Real Betis until 2027, a testament to the club's faith in his abilities and potential.

His professional debut came in a challenging setting, substituting in a UEFA Europa League match against Rangers on 21st September 2023, which ended in a narrow 1–0 loss.

Despite the outcome, this match marked a significant milestone in Diao's burgeoning career, showcasing his readiness for senior-level competition.



How Has Diao Performed Internationally?

Eligible for both Senegal and Spain, Diao has chosen to represent Spain thus far, contributing to the under-19 team at the 2023 UEFA European Under-19 Championship.

This decision underscores his multicultural background and his desire to make an impact on the international stage.

What Does Diao Bring to the Pitch?

Initially trained as a midfielder, Diao's transition to the wing utilises his strength, power, and technical skill effectively. His ability to deliver precise crosses, coupled with ambidexterity, makes him a formidable force on the pitch. Moreover, his technique and heading capability add to his versatility, making him a valuable asset to his team.

Assane Diao playing stats

Assane Diao Diaoune's FBref statistics paint a picture of a player with a diverse skill set, notable both for his potential in attacking contributions and his robust defensive work.

With a fairly normal goal-scoring rate of 0.21 per 90 minutes, placing him in the 43rd percentile, Diao shows average in front of goal.

His non-penalty expected goals (npxG) of 0.28 per 90 minutes is particularly impressive, landing him in the 77th percentile and indicating a capacity to find scoring positions.

His total shots per 90 minutes stand at 1.94, with shot-creating actions per 90 minutes at an exceptional 2.29, highlighting his critical role in offensive playmaking.

Despite a lower percentile in assists and expected assisted goals, Diao's overall contribution to the team's attacking dynamics, evidenced by his high percentile in progressive actions and dribbles, showcases his importance to Real Betis' offensive strategy.

Assane Diao's attacking stats analysis

In the attacking domain, Diao's performances in both the Europa League and La Liga demonstrate his capability to contribute significantly. Scoring 3 goals across both competitions with average shots per game of 1.2, Diao's ability to threaten the goal is clear.

While his assists may not reflect his overall contribution, his key passes and dribbles per game indicate a player who is actively engaging in offensive plays, creating chances, and taking on defenders.

Assane Diao's defensive contributions

Defensively, Diao's stats reveal an active engagement in the game's less glamorous aspects. With an average of 1.1 tackles per game in La Liga and 0.6 in the Europa League, alongside modest interception and clearance numbers, he contributes more than might be expected from a winger.

His defensive work rate, including a high percentile in blocks and competitive performance in aerial duels, demonstrates his versatility and willingness to contribute to team efforts beyond just attacking plays.

Assane Diao's general play and passing stats

Diao's general play and passing statistics offer insight into his style and effectiveness on the field. His pass completion rate of 76.6% reflects a player comfortable with the ball, and capable of maintaining possession under pressure.

Despite lower assist numbers, his average key passes per game and progressive passing metrics suggest a player always looking to advance play and create opportunities.

His contributions are not limited to passing, with his rating reflecting a well-rounded player who impacts the game across multiple facets, from precise passing in both the Europa League and La Liga to contributing defensively and offensively.

Off the Pitch: Who is Assane Diao Diaoune?

Personal life details such as his twin brother, Ousseynou, also pursuing football in Spain, paint a picture of a grounded individual with a strong family connection to the sport. This bond undoubtedly fuels his ambition and dedication.

Assane Diao Diaoune's early foray into professional football with Real Betis highlights a promising career ahead. His adaptability, from midfield to wing, combined with his technical skills, positions him as a significant prospect for both his club and country. As he continues to develop and adapt to the challenges of top-tier football, the football world eagerly watches this young talent's journey.

Given his trajectory and the strategic investment by Real Betis in securing his talents until 2027, Diao is poised for substantial growth.

With several clubs interested in picking up the wonderkid for a bargain price of €30 million, which is allegedly the price of his release clause, Real Betis may be bracing themselves to lose an incredible talent if they can't tie him down to a new contract.
